Output 758455b3f7bc44dc807de75cef55f07f0ff014e27af61e3083e1c61e61a97e27:0

value
593900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22fd1a1487e3c00421c2eff9849f598de6532028 OP_EQUAL
address
MB6AQn8ywEqvrzi9JTwQXUCM4A3XAxuDJc
transaction
758455b3f7bc44dc807de75cef55f07f0ff014e27af61e3083e1c61e61a97e27
spent
true